Variables That Most Change the Final Quote
Understanding what shifts the price helps in re-scoping and negotiating. The strongest drivers are the shell type and the pool size, plus regional permitting complexity. Numeric thresholds: shell choice shifts price by 20%–35%; pool area above 1,000 sq ft commonly increases costs by 15%–25% as more features are bundled.
Other influential factors include soil condition requiring rock removal, depth variations exceeding 6 feet, and the inclusion of advanced energy-saving equipment with higher upfront costs but lower long-term operating expenses.

System Type Choices and Their Price Impacts
Concrete shells offer durability and design flexibility but come with higher initial costs; vinyl can lower upfront pricing but may incur higher long-term maintenance. Fiberglass provides quicker installation. System-type price impact: concrete 30%–60% higher than vinyl for similar footprints; fiberglass adds 10%–25% premium over vinyl but reduces construction time.
For example, a 1,000 sq ft pool with a basic lighted deck and standard filtration might range from $1,000,000 to $2,000,000 with concrete, while vinyl could be $700,000 to $1,400,000 and fiberglass $900,000 to $1,800,000 depending on site access.
Module: Energy, Lighting, and Automation Add-Ons
Smart controls, variable speed pumps, and energy-efficient LED lighting can add $15,000–$60,000 to the project, but often reduce ongoing operating costs. Payback periods commonly run 3–7 years depending on usage and local electricity rates.
Automation can improve safety and maintenance efficiency, while solar-ready or heat-pump integration increases both price and long-term savings.
Delivery, Excavation, and Backfill Considerations
Logistics and site access can push prices higher when heavy equipment must be mobilized or when soil is unsuitable. Expect excavation and backfill to contribute $60,000–$420,000 on larger sites. Roughly 50% of site costs occur before any shell work begins, so early site investigations matter.
